Which series falls in ultra violet region?
A
Lyman
B
Brachett
C
Pfund
D
Paschen

Official Correct Choice:
Option A: Lyman
Concept: Spectral lines are grouped by the lowest energy state involved in the transition. The larger the atomic drop, the higher the energy and the shorter the wavelength.

Formula:
$$ \text{Lyman} \implies p = 1 $$

Solution:
  • The Lyman series is defined by transitions down to the ground state (\( n=1 \)).
  • Because the energy gap between \( n=1 \) and any higher state is the largest in the hydrogen atom, these transitions yield the highest energy photons.
  • High energy correlates with short wavelengths, placing these emissions entirely within the Ultraviolet (UV) light band.


Why other options are incorrect:
Brackett (spelled 'Brachett' in the original exam), Pfund, and Paschen all involve transitions to much higher orbits (\( n=4, 5, 3 \) respectively). These smaller drops emit low-energy Infrared radiation.
